As a developer tools analyst, I've compared Project A (Plausible Analytics) and Project B (Prefect) based on their momentum, community size, and apparent use cases. Here's a detailed analysis for senior engineers: **Momentum and Community Size** Project A, with 24,464 stars and a recent gain of 154 stars over 30 days, indicates a established yet moderately growing community. In contrast, Project B, boasting 22,087 stars but with a more significant recent surge of 243 stars in the last 30 days, suggests a currently more dynamic and rapidly expanding community. **Apparent Use Cases** Project A is clearly positioned as a lightweight, privacy-focused web analytics solution, appealing to developers seeking an alternative to Google Analytics, particularly for smaller to medium-sized projects or those with stringent privacy requirements. Project B, as a workflow orchestration framework, targets a broader and more complex use case, catering to data engineers and teams building resilient data pipelines in Python, implying adoption in more enterprise-level or data-intensive environments. **Comparison Summary** - **Star Count**: Project A leads in total stars, reflecting its longer-established presence. - **Recent Growth**: Project B surpasses in recent star acquisition, indicating stronger current momentum. - **Community and Use Case Alignment**: Project A's community is focused on privacy-conscious web analytics, while Project B's community is geared towards complex data workflow orchestration, attracting a potentially larger and more diverse set of users due to the ubiquity of data pipeline challenges.
